Foreign Office

The Foreign Office is a government department responsible for Britain's international relations, diplomacy, and foreign policy. It is best known for coordinating embassies and consulates worldwide, negotiating treaties, and shaping UK foreign policy, including crisis response and sanctions diplomacy. It remains relevant in current news as the central actor in Britain's responses to global events, alliances, and international negotiations on security, trade, and humanitarian issues.
